Here is the recipe for MY Mango Tango Daiquiri:

  • 1 1/2 shots rum
  • 2 1/2 shots mango puree
  • 1/2 shot cream of coconut
  • 2 shots pineapple juice
  • 1/4 shot lime juice

As I had said, I had to keep increasing the amounts of each ingredient, so this is going to make a little more then one cocktail......but honestly, is is that a bad thing?  Not in my book!

In a blender add 1 cup of ice, rum, mango puree, cream of coconut, pineapple juice and lime juice.  Blend until there is no more ice, it should be a liquid.  Pour and enjoy!!

Here is the recipe for MY Swing'n Banana Daiquiri:

  • 1 1/2 shots of rum
  • 1 shot Banana Puree
  • 1/2 shot cream of coconut
  • 3 shots pineapple juice

In a blender, put 1 cup of ice, rum, banana puree, cream of coconut and pineapple juice.  Blend it up so that there are no little pieces of ice left, just a complete liquid.  Pour into a margarita glass and enjoy!!
